About Langham Village School
We strive to achieve a happy atmosphere with good, trusting relationships between adults and children alike. We fully embrace the ‘Every Child Matters’ agenda and always strive to provide a caring and safe environment.
The present building is just over 100 years old but, with its lowered ceiling and large windows, a soft climate is created – unusual for a Victorian school. We have 81 children, (January 2008) with 12 pupils in Year Two and 6 Pupils in Year Six. Numbers have increased significantly since 1991 when the present Headteacher took up his position.
We have experienced three OFSTED inspections all of which have judged us as being a 'good school' - the most recent of these being at the beginning of November 2006. You can download the report as a pdf file from the OFSTED Report page.
